You'll work at the intersection of entertainment and technology ensuring that the networks powering content creation for Prime Video, Amazon MGM Studios, and our original productions are reliable, scalable, and secure., * Own the network architecture roadmap across studio production facilities. * Design and optimize enterprise network and WiFi for high-density studio and stage environments. * Work with Amazon Security to build zero-trust network solutions and maintain compliance with content protection standards. * Support and troubleshoot network, compute and storage systems (NAS, SAN, media servers) on-premises and cloud. * Build automation to reduce manual work and keep environments consistent. * Manage vendor relationships, contracts, and SLAs for connectivity services. * Plan capacity for upcoming productions, facility growth, and new tech rollouts. * Mentor engineers and set technical standards for the team. * Connect on-premises production environments to cloud services. * Provide white-glove support for active productions, troubleshooting network, WiFi, and infrastructure issues with urgency. * Respond to escalations and work with vendors to resolve outages quickly.
